UDOT and DPS to release preliminary 2017 traffic fatality numbers
New safety campaign launched to cut down on distracted driving
WHAT: On Wednesday, the Utah Department of Transportation (UDOT) and the Department of Public Safety (DPS) will release preliminary traffic fatality numbers for 2017 and kick off a new safety campaign aimed at reducing distracted driving. UDOT and DPS leaders will be available at 9:30 a.m. for one-on-one interviews.
Prior to the media availability, the preliminary 2017 fatalities report will be emailed to media around 8 a.m. Wednesday to allow time for review.
WHEN: Wednesday, January 17, 2018, at 9:30 a.m.
